Fig. D.1
(
a
) The rgb triangle inside the RGB color cube. (
b
) The rgb triangle

Fig. D.2
The location of

different points used to define

saturation

min

{
P
R
,P
G
,P
B
}

P
R
+

S
=

1

−

3

·

(D.4)

P
G
+

P
B

Similar arguments hold for the other two triangles
WG
B
and
WB
R
and Eq.
D.4

is therefore the general expression for saturation in the HSI representation.

Hue is defined as the angle,
θ
, between the two vectors
−−
WR
and
−−
WP
,see

Fig. 3.11. Referring to Eq.
B.16
we can express the angle between the vectors as

cos
−
1

−−
WR
•
−−
WP

−−
WR
·
−−
WP

θ
=

(D.5)

Inserting the actual points yields

⎡

⎤

⎡

⎤

⎡

⎤

1

0

0

1
/
3

1
/
3

1
/
3

2
/
3

−−
WR
=
R
−
W
=

⎣

⎦
−

⎣

⎦
=

⎣

⎦

−

1
/
3

(D.6)

−

1
/
3

(
2
/
3
)
2

6
/
9

2
/
3

−−
WR
=

1
/
3
)
2

1
/
3
)
2

+

(

−

+

(

−

=

=

(D.7)

⎡

⎤

⎡

⎤

⎡

⎤

P
r

P
g

P
b

1
/
3

1
/
3

1
/
3

P
r
−

1
/
3

−−
WP

=
P

−
W

⎣

⎦
−

⎣

⎦
=

⎣

⎦

=

P
g
−

1
/
3

(D.8)

P
b
−

1
/
3

(P
r
−

−−
WP

1
/
3
)
2

1
/
3
)
2

1
/
3
)
2

=

+

(P
g
−

+

(P
b
−

⇔